The people of Kingswinford should have a voice that is heard. This is our community.
1) Increase in traffic on already overused roads there is already a problem driving in and out of Kingswinford especially at peak times. Hanson rates parts of Kingswinford as having the want community score from have to employment. Plus there will be an increase in CO2 emissions and the quality of life.
2) There are insufficient school places for those already living in the area and even loss support for the parents trying to get them to school.
3) The waiting time for NHS appointments I through the whole spectrum is unacceptable, there are no feasible plans to improve this.
4) The loss of green space will effect local wildlife and the people who live here. Once this space is gone it cannot be replaced. Replanting schemes cannot replace ancient habitats.
